Twitter was abuzz with Sanju Samson’s save in the final over of the 1st ODI played between India and West Indies at the Port of Spain in Trinidad. Sanju Samson redeemed himself with a diving save while keeping wickets in the final over of the game when the West Indies just needed 15 runs in the final over of Mohammed Siraj with 4 wickets in hand.

Team India lost the toss and were invited to bat first by the Caribbean skipper, Nicholas Pooran. Captain Shikhar Dhawan and Shubman Gill gave India the perfect start as they knit a century stand between themselves. Shikhar Dhawan missed his century by just 3 runs as he was dismissed on 97 runs, which was his 6th dismissal in the nervous 90s.

Shreyas Iyer also scored a great half-century and after Iyer’s wicket, the Indian batting collapsed with a few contributions from Suryakumar Yadav, Sanju Samson, and Deepak Hooda. Axar Patel also managed to score 21 runs at a strike rate of 100 and team India finished on 308 runs for the loss of 7 wickets in their 50 overs.

Coming to the chase, The West Indians were dealt with an early blow in the form of Shai Hope. However, Shamarh Brooks and Kyle Mayers put up a 100-run partnership for the second wicket and provided stability to the West Indies innings. Brandon King also scored a massive half-century as West Indies cruised towards the target.

Fireworks from Romario Shepherd towards the end of the West Indies innings brought them the bring of victory. In the final over of the match, the Windies needed just 15 runs with the set pair of Akeal Hosein and Romario Shepherd batting. If not for Sanju Samson’s diving save on the 5th delivery of the final over, the ball would have travelled to the boundary and India could’ve lost the game.

India will now take on West Indies in the 2nd ODI of the series on July 24 at the Port of Spain in Trinidad with a 1-0 lead in the 3-match series. The Men in Blue will also play 5 T20Is against the Caribbeans after the ODI series comes to a close.
